Explain the importance of collaboration and teamwork among international crew members on the ISS.



Collaboration and teamwork among international crew members on the International Space Station (ISS) play a vital role in the success of space missions and contribute to the overall objectives of scientific research, exploration, and technological advancements. Here are several reasons highlighting the importance of collaboration and teamwork on the ISS:

1. Cultural Exchange and Understanding:

* International Crew Composition: The ISS brings together astronauts from different countries, cultures, and backgrounds. Collaboration fosters cultural exchange, allowing crew members to gain a deeper understanding and appreciation of diverse perspectives, traditions, and approaches to problem-solving.
* Mutual Respect: Collaboration on the ISS promotes mutual respect among crew members, acknowledging the value of different experiences and expertise. This enhances cooperation and creates a harmonious working environment, facilitating effective communication and decision-making.
2. Shared Expertise and Knowledge:

* Complementary Skills: Each international crew member on the ISS brings unique skills, training, and experiences to the team. Collaboration allows for the pooling of expertise in various scientific disciplines, engineering, operations, and space exploration, leading to more comprehensive problem-solving and innovative solutions.
* Cross-Training Opportunities: Crew members have the opportunity to learn from one another, sharing knowledge and acquiring new skills. This cross-training enhances the versatility of crew members, enabling them to perform a wide range of tasks and handle unexpected situations during their time on the ISS.
3. Multidisciplinary Research and Science:

* Collaborative Research Projects: Collaboration among international crew members facilitates multidisciplinary research projects on the ISS. Crew members from different countries can combine their expertise to conduct complex experiments, gather diverse data sets, and analyze results collaboratively. This approach promotes scientific breakthroughs and advancements in various fields, including physics, biology, medicine, and Earth observation.
* Interdisciplinary Problem-Solving: The complex challenges encountered on the ISS often require an interdisciplinary approach. By working together, crew members can tackle issues that span different scientific domains, leading to innovative solutions and a deeper understanding of the intricacies of space exploration and living in microgravity.
4. Safety and Mission Success:

* Redundancy and Backups: Collaboration enhances safety and mission success on the ISS by ensuring redundancy and backup plans. International crew members can support one another during critical operations, emergencies, and contingencies, providing additional layers of protection and problem-solving capabilities.
* Monitoring and Support: Crew members collaboratively monitor various systems, equipment, and experiments on the ISS. By working together, they can identify potential issues, troubleshoot problems, and implement solutions swiftly, minimizing risks and ensuring the smooth functioning of the station.
5. Diplomacy and International Relations:

* International Cooperation: Collaboration on the ISS serves as a symbol of international cooperation and peaceful coexistence. It demonstrates that nations can come together to pursue common goals, despite political differences or conflicts. The shared experience of working and living in space fosters goodwill, builds trust, and strengthens diplomatic ties among participating countries.
* Diplomatic Impact: The success of international collaborations on the ISS can positively influence diplomatic relationships between nations involved. These collaborations can open doors for further joint space missions, technological partnerships, and scientific collaborations beyond the ISS program.

In summary, collaboration and teamwork among international crew members on the ISS are crucial for achieving the objectives of scientific research, exploration, and technological advancements. Through cultural exchange, shared expertise, multidisciplinary research, safety considerations, and diplomatic impact, collaboration fosters an environment of mutual respect, innovation, and international cooperation. The collaborative efforts on the ISS showcase the power of teamwork and serve as a testament to humanity's collective ability to explore and thrive in the challenging environment of space.
